Verdict

Micky Hammond's pair, Danceintothelight and Amir Pasha, are the only previous course winners in this amateur riders' handicap and both have scored off much higher mark. The former will have Alice Mills' claim in his favour, though has gone up the same amount for finishing second over track and trip at the start of the month. King's Chorister is capable off his current mark while Some Lad has been running well and was just touched off at Newcastle last week, though may not be as effective over this longer distance. LIGHTS OF BROADWAY is a rare runner here for Caerphilly trainer Bernard Llewellyn and can return home with the spoils as this looks a tad easier than recent tests.
